Hi Phillip. Take a look at the articles on Rick Strahl's website at
http://www.west-wind.com/Articles.asp

I think between using wwipstuff and reading his articles, you should be able to piece this together. wwipstuff allows you to get a webpages into a string. So you can do stuff like start an webpage with a paramenter passed to it.

>Are there any theories on how an application could communicate interactively, in an automated fashion, with active server pages (ASPs) on a website?
>
>Essentially, the application needs to pass query parameters to an ASP on some webserver, then "scrape" the query results page to retrieve the data. I don't know if this is even possible, but we have been asked to do it. Do we *need* to go through a browser to talk to the ASP?
